Two points that I forgot to add yesterday: 

1. I'd describe current Chandler Hub interop with iCal 4.x as at least as
good as interop with iCal 3.x. 

2. At a glance, at least some of the interop issues that existed with 3.x
remain with 4.x, but they shouldn't be show-stoppers. Things like: 

 * if you drag a to do from the sidebar of iCal to the calendar, you'll get
an offspring of the item (not comparable to Chandler-style conversion, of a
single note, to an event) (duplication is probably not the best word, but it
sometimes feels like it)

 * with that offspring or its parent (I can't recall which), sync issues may
occur, silently; with no warning from iCal.
